Here Are 11 Good Reasons Why Students Fail JAMB UTME

In order to achieve success in JAMB exams and secure admission into higher institutions, it is important for students to avoid common mistakes that often lead to failure.

  1. Neglecting the Syllabus: The JAMB syllabus is a valuable tool for exam preparation. Research has shown that students who thoroughly study the syllabus have a higher chance of success. It is essential for candidates to carefully review the syllabus for each subject they have registered for. By focusing on the relevant topics outlined in the syllabus, students can optimize their study time and avoid wasting effort on irrelevant materials.
  2. Ignoring the Brochure: The JAMB brochure provides important information about available courses and admission requirements. Unfortunately, many students neglect this resource and end up registering for courses that may not be offered by their desired universities. To make informed decisions and select suitable courses, candidates should study the brochure carefully before filling out the JAMB registration form.
  3. Poor Study Habits: Success in JAMB exams is directly linked to diligent study habits. Despite having access to the syllabus and brochure, some students fail to prioritize their studies effectively. It is crucial for candidates to devote sufficient time to studying their textbooks and recommended materials. Even with busy schedules, creating a study plan and attending extra classes can greatly enhance preparation.
  4. Late Registration: Time management is crucial when it comes to JAMB exams. Although there is a designated registration period, procrastinating and registering late can have adverse effects. Late registrants may be assigned to inconvenient or poorly equipped exam centers, potentially leading to suboptimal conditions and increased chances of failure. Candidates should register early to secure better exam arrangements.
  5. Lack of Speed: JAMB UTME exams have time constraints, requiring candidates to work efficiently. The limited time given for each section necessitates swift and accurate responses. Students who can answer questions promptly and manage their time effectively are more likely to succeed. It is important to practice time management skills and improve speed in order to complete the exam within the allocated time frame.
  6. Arriving Late to the Exam Venue: Arriving late to the exam venue can result in disqualification, regardless of a candidate’s abilities. Punctuality is crucial. Students should plan their journey in advance, especially if they need to travel long distances or to another state. Arriving at the exam center early helps eliminate unnecessary stress and ensures a smooth start to the exam.
  7. Computer Illiteracy: Since 2014, JAMB exams have been conducted in a computer-based format. Despite the widespread availability of computers, many students still lack proficiency in operating them during exams. Candidates should undertake computer-based training prior to the exam day to familiarize themselves with the format and minimize the risk of failure due to technical difficulties.
  8. Incomplete Materials: On the exam day, candidates must ensure they have all the necessary materials. This includes the JAMB printout, passports, and any other required documents. It is crucial to carefully read and follow the instructions provided. For instance, if a color printout is specified, bringing a black and white printout may lead to complications.
  9. Neglecting Attendance: During the exam, students must pay close attention to attendance procedures. Failure to respond to attendance calls may result in being marked absent, even if the exam is completed. Candidates should remain attentive and follow instructions carefully to ensure their attendance is properly recorded.
  10. Unconducive Exam Centers: JAMB exams in Nigeria have often been criticized for inadequate and poorly equipped exam centers. Unfortunately, this subpar environment can negatively impact students’ performance. While candidates have no control over the centers assigned to them, being mentally prepared for the conditions can help alleviate stress and maintain focus during the exam.
  11. Misinformation: Misinformation about JAMB exams is widespread, leading to misconceptions and confusion among students. It is essential to be discerning and rely on accurate information from reliable sources. Many rumors and myths surrounding the exams should be treated with caution. Candidates should seek guidance from official JAMB sources or trusted educational institutions.
